This episode includes segments on the 35th anniversary of the Corporation of Public Broadcasting (PBS), the Weekly News Analysis, and the 22nd anniversary of Howard University Television (WHUT). First, leaders of public broadcasting discuss the history of PBS, its achievements, and the challenges that it faces. Next, guests talk about the recent Osama Bin Laden tape. They also discuss the impending Iraq War and what the panelists feel is an unrealistic forecast by the federal government that it will only be a six-month campaign. In the final segment, the founders of WHMM, the precursor to WHUT, discuss the launch of the first black public television channel at Howard University.
